> Ok.  Right now, the mips kernel doesn't build unless I have random =
built
> in, we were using it as a module previously. =20


I'm testing a fix, but if you want to help out, please move the =
random_null_func()
from randomdev.c to pseudo_rng.c in sys/dev/random. Patch enclosed.
